例如:tar -cvf bak.tar /IBM/gdncbak/bak.txt 可以打包成功
但是tar -xvf bak.tar 解压时会覆盖掉原bak.txt
加上-C后用tar -xvf bak.tar -C /IBM/ 会报错,提示-C不包含在文档中
请问如何tar解压到指定目录?
收起tar命令是Unix/Linux系统中备份文件的可靠方法,几乎可以工作于任何环境中,它的使用权限是所有用户。
解压参数说明:
-x : --extract,--get 解开tar文件。
-v : --verbose 列出每一步处理涉及的文件的信息,只用一个“v”时,仅列出文件名,使用两个“v”时,列出权限、所有者、大小、时间、文件名等信息。
-f : --file [主机名:]文件名 指定要处理的文件名。可以用“-”代表标准输出或标准输入。
-C,--directory DIR 转到指定的目录.